Sure, on the surface, yes, the core has been exhausted.
Theres some batting of the eyelashesoomphdeep within this trend.
The aesthetic arrived in 2020, trotting towards us in silkballet flatsand little bows, armed with Vladimir NabokovsLolita.
Since then, its been ebbing in and out of popularity.
Yet, Id argue that the cores perverse seduction is still very much alive.
